Source Code Expand
use libm::erfc;
use proconio::{input, source::line::LineSource};
use rand::seq::SliceRandom;
use std::{
collections::HashSet,
io::{stdin, BufReader, StdinLock},
};
fn measure(i: usize, x: i32, y: i32, source: &mut LineSource<BufReader<StdinLock<'_>>>) -> i32 {
static mut COUNT: usize = 0;
unsafe { COUNT += 1 };
if unsafe { COUNT } > 10000 {
return -1;
}
println!("{} {} {}", i, x, y);
input! {
from &mut *source,
measure_result: i32
};
return measure_result;
}
// P(X <= x)
fn prob(x: f64, stdev: i32) -> f64 {
erfc(-x / (stdev as f64 * 2.0_f64.sqrt())) / 2.0
}
fn main() {
let stdin = stdin();
let mut source = LineSource::new(BufReader::new(stdin.lock()));
input! {
from &mut source,
grid_size: usize,
num_exit: usize,
stdev: i32,
exit_cells: [(usize, usize); num_exit]
};
let mut temps = vec![vec![0; grid_size]; grid_size];
let center = (grid_size / 2, grid_size / 2);
temps[center.0][center.1] = (8 * stdev).min(1000);
// output temps
for i in 0..grid_size {
for j in 0..grid_size {
print!("{} ", temps[i][j].min(1000).max(0));
}
println!("");
}
// measure
let ans_undecided = 10000000;
let mut ans = vec![ans_undecided; num_exit];
let mut remaining = HashSet::<usize>::new();
for i in 0..num_exit {
remaining.insert(i);
}
let mut rng = rand::thread_rng();
let mut ordered_exitidx = (0..num_exit).collect::<Vec<usize>>();
let mut perm = (0..num_exit).collect::<Vec<usize>>();
ordered_exitidx.sort_by(|a, b| {
((exit_cells[*a].0 as i32 - center.0 as i32).abs()
+ (exit_cells[*a].1 as i32 - center.1 as i32).abs())
.cmp(
&((exit_cells[*b].0 as i32 - center.0 as i32).abs()
+ (exit_cells[*b].1 as i32 - center.1 as i32).abs()),
)
});
for i in 0..num_exit {
perm.shuffle(&mut rng);
for _j in 0..num_exit {
let j = perm[_j];
if !remaining.contains(&j) {
continue;
}
let one_acceptance = 0.9999;
let zero_acceptance = 0.85;
let mut percentage_one = 0.35;
while percentage_one < one_acceptance && (1.0 - percentage_one) < zero_acceptance {
let measure_result = measure(
j,
center.0 as i32 - exit_cells[ordered_exitidx[i]].0 as i32,
center.1 as i32 - exit_cells[ordered_exitidx[i]].1 as i32,
&mut source,
);
if measure_result == -1 {
break;
}
let percentage_zero = 1.0 - percentage_one;
let t = temps[center.0][center.1];
let prob_one = if measure_result >= t {
prob(0.5, stdev)
} else if measure_result == 0 {
prob(-t as f64 + 0.5, stdev)
} else {
prob((measure_result - t) as f64 + 0.5, stdev)
- prob((measure_result - t) as f64 - 0.5, stdev)
};
let prob_zero = if measure_result == 0 {
prob(0.5, stdev)
} else if measure_result >= t {
prob(-t as f64 + 0.5, stdev)
} else {
prob(-measure_result as f64 + 0.5, stdev)
- prob(-measure_result as f64 - 0.5, stdev)
};
let sum = percentage_one * prob_one + percentage_zero * prob_zero;
percentage_one = percentage_one * prob_one / sum;
// eprintln!(
// "P1:{}, prob1:{}, prob0:{} res:{}",
// percentage_one, prob_one, prob_zero, measure_result
// );
}
if percentage_one > one_acceptance {
ans[j] = ordered_exitidx[i];
remaining.remove(&j);
break;
}
}
}
if remaining.len() > 0 {
let mut remaining = HashSet::<usize>::new();
for i in 0..num_exit {
remaining.insert(i);
}
for i in 0..num_exit {
if ans[i] != ans_undecided {
remaining.remove(&i);
}
}
eprintln!("remaining: {:?}", remaining);
let rem = remaining.iter().next().unwrap().clone();
for i in 0..num_exit {
if ans[i] == ans_undecided {
ans[i] = rem;
}
}
}
// output results
println!("-1 -1 -1");
for i in 0..num_exit {
println!("{}", ans[i]);
}
}
